The Octave Alto SDKs (formerly the Luciad Portfolio) provide a comprehensive suite of developer toolkits for building high‑performance geospatial applications across desktop, web, and embedded environments. Alto Server enables secure data management and on‑the‑fly fusion of large spatial datasets; Alto Lightspeed delivers advanced 2D/3D/4D visualization and analytics for complex, time‑dynamic environments; Alto Browser offers lightweight, high‑performance geospatial web visualization; and Alto Universal gives developers a cross‑platform graphics engine with native C++ and C# APIs for demanding visualization workloads. Together, they offer support for rich geospatial formats, real‑time data handling, styling, analytics, and precision rendering. What do you like best about Octave Alto SDKs (Luciad)?

The biggest strength for me was how complete the geospatial capabilities were. It supports large map datasets, different coordinate reference systems, terrain visualization and many common GIS formats, so we didn’t have to build those pieces ourselves. That let us spend more time on the application logic instead of solving low level mapping problems.

Our work involved bathymetric grids and terrain models as part of petroleum related academic research. Being able to integrate and visualize those datasets in a custom application made the workflow much simpler and easier to maintain. Some of the datasets were quite large, but navigation and rendering was generally smooth.

I also liked that the SDK gives developers a lot of flexibility. We could adapt the application to what researchers and professors needed, instead of trying to fit their workflow into a generic GIS tool. There is a learning curve, but once you understand the architecture it becomes much easier to extend and integrate with existing systems. Review collected by and hosted on G2.com.

What do you dislike about Octave Alto SDKs (Luciad)?

The biggest challenge was the learning curve. If you already have experience with GIS concepts it helps a lot, but there is still quite a bit to learn before you become productive. We spent time working closely with professors and PhD students to understand the data and the research workflow before we could implement the software side properly.

Debugging geospatial issues can also take time because problems are not always obvious. A small mistake in coordinate systems or data transformations can produce results that look correct at first glance but are actually wrong.

Since this was part of a university research project, licensing and procurement were handled by the program funding, so I wasn’t involved with pricing or evaluating the commercial side of the product. I also can’t comment much on vendor support because most of the knowledge came from the research team and our own experimentation. Review collected by and hosted on G2.com.

What problems is Octave Alto SDKs (Luciad) solving and how is that benefiting you?

The main problem it solved for us was making complex geospatial data accessible through a custom application instead of relying only on traditional GIS tools. Our project involved bathymetric grids, terrain models and other spatial datasets used in petroleum related academic research. Researchers needed a way to visualize and interact with this information as part of their studies, while we needed a reliable platform to build the application around it.

From a development perspective, it saved us from implementing many GIS features from scratch, like handling different coordinate systems, map visualization and large spatial datasets. That reduced development time and let us focus more on the research workflow and the data processing that was specific to our project.

At the time I used the product it was still under its previous Luciad branding, well before the recent AI wave. Because of that I didn’t use any AI assisted capabilities, so my experience is based on its core geospatial SDK and visualization features. The biggest benefit was that researchers and students could work with the information in a way that fit their workflow, instead of us trying to adapt everything around a generic mapping solution. What do you like best about Octave Alto SDKs (Luciad)?

Octave Alto SDKs, from Hexagon (formerly Luciad), are well-known in the geospatial and defense/aviation visualization fields. Here are the commonly cited advantages:

Rendering and Performance

- Offers extremely high-performance 2D and 3D map rendering, handling millions of objects smoothly.

- Features a hardware-accelerated graphics pipeline optimized for real-time situational awareness displays.

- Manages large datasets (terrain, imagery, vector data) with level-of-detail streaming.

Geospatial Standards Support

- Provides broad support for OGC standards, including WMS, WMTS, WFS, WCS, GML, KML, SHP, and GeoJSON.

- Includes native support for military symbology, such as MIL-STD-2525 and APP-6.

- Offers strong support for aviation-specific formats, including AIXM, DAFIF, and AIS data.

Developer Experience

- Contains well-documented APIs with clear object models for map layers, features, and styling.

- Is available on multiple platforms, including Java/Swing, JavaScript/WebGL, Android, and iOS.

- Features a component-based architecture that integrates easily into existing applications.

- Comes with a rich set of built-in tools, including measurement, editing, line-of-sight, and viewshed analysis.

Domain Fit (Aviation/Defense/ATC)

- Designed specifically for command-and-control, air traffic management, and defense use cases.

- Supports real-time data ingestion and visualization, including tracks, flights, and sensor feeds.

- Offers 4D trajectory visualization and handles temporal data effectively.

- Provides comprehensive coordinate reference system support and manages projections smoothly.

Customizability

- Allows fine-grained control over rendering pipelines and styling rules.

- Features an extensible layer and codec architecture for proprietary data formats.

- Supports custom interaction controllers and UI overlays.

Reliability

- A mature product with over 20 years on the market, tested in critical deployments.

- Offers strong enterprise support and professional services from Hexagon.

Many users note that the downsides include the proprietary licensing cost and the learning curve for the more advanced 3D and temporal features. However, for organizations needing production-grade geospatial visualization, especially in aviation and defense, it remains one of the strongest options available. What do you dislike about Octave Alto SDKs (Luciad)?

Cost & Licensing

The licensing is expensive and the pricing is unclear, requiring interaction with sales. Managing licenses can be difficult in CI/CD and containerized environments.

Steep Learning Curve

The API is overly abstracted in some areas, which means you need to understand several layers for simple tasks. Documentation relies heavily on references and lacks practical tutorials. The small public community limits help on Stack Overflow, making you dependent on vendor support.

Modernization Gaps

The Java/Swing SDK feels outdated. The JavaScript SDK (LuciadRIA) is more modern but has historically not kept up with features. There are no strong bindings for React or Angular, so integrating with modern frontend frameworks involves extra code.

Closed Ecosystem

There is no public issue tracker, roadmap, or plugin marketplace. Almost all integrations require custom work. The small community compared to open-source alternatives like Cesium, Mapbox, and OpenLayers means there are fewer shared solutions.

Vendor Lock-in

The tight connection to Luciad-specific APIs and data models makes switching to another solution costly later. Major upgrades often require a lot of migration work.

DevOps Friction

The large SDK size, license checks during build processes, and limited guidance on cloud-native deployment add to operational challenges.

The bottom line: This is a powerful, mature toolkit for defense and aviation visualization. However, the closed ecosystem, high costs, and integration challenges make it hard to justify unless you specifically need its specialized features. Review collected by and hosted on G2.com.

What problems is Octave Alto SDKs (Luciad) solving and how is that benefiting you?

Problems Solved

Octave Alto SDKs address the challenge of creating high-performance geospatial visualization for important fields like aviation, defense, and air traffic control. Generic mapping tools cannot meet the demands of these areas.

Real-time situational awareness: It displays thousands of moving objects, such as aircraft, vessels, and tracks, with updates in under a second. This gives operators a live view they can act on.

Data fusion: It combines terrain, weather, radar, flight tracks, airspace boundaries, and military symbols into one clear 2D/3D view. This integration would typically require months of custom development.

Standards compliance: It natively supports aviation formats like AIXM and DAFIF, military symbols per MIL-STD-2525, and OGC standards. This support removes the need for custom codec work for regulated data.

4D temporal handling: It includes trajectory playback, historical analysis, and predictive path rendering. These features are essential for flight operations and debriefing.

Benefits

It significantly reduces the time to market for operational geospatial displays.

It has proven reliability in safety-critical environments where rendering failures can have serious consequences.

It allows teams to focus on domain logic rather than low-level graphics and format issues.

It offers a consistent programming model from desktop to web. Review collected by and hosted on G2.com.

What do you like best about Octave Alto SDKs (Luciad)?

I love that Octave Alto SDKs (Luciad) can handle 50,000 moving assets on a 3D globe with zero frame drops, making it a powerhouse for geospatial development. The ability to layer different data formats, like 3D meshes, LiDAR point clouds, and live radar feeds, without any file conversion hassle is a massive plus for me. The hardware-accelerated speed is impressive, especially with modern APIs like WebGPU and Vulkan, keeping everything running smoothly at 60 FPS. I appreciate the flawless math the geodetic engine provides, ensuring accurate global coordinate transformations and perfect physical positioning on a 3D globe. This kind of precision makes it the gold standard for aviation and defense. Overall, it takes the tech headaches off my plate so I can focus on managing actual operations. Review collected by and hosted on G2.com.

What do you dislike about Octave Alto SDKs (Luciad)?

Prohibitive Cost: It is strictly priced for defense and massive enterprise budgets, with complex licensing that rules out smaller projects. Steep Learning Curve: The API is incredibly deep and complex. It requires significant onboarding time; you won't be building quick prototypes in a single afternoon. Overkill for Simple Tasks: If your project doesn't genuinely need heavy 3D streaming or massive asset tracking, it introduces unnecessary architectural overhead. Thin Advanced Documentation: While standard setup is well-covered, figuring out complex custom integrations often requires relying heavily on enterprise support tickets.
